丛枝菌根真菌与菌根辅助细菌互作对番茄生长的影响

Effects of Arbuscular Mycorrhizal Fungi and Mycorrhizal Helper Bacteria Interaction on Tomato Growth
原文传递
导出
摘要 以番茄(Solanum lycopersicum L.)为试材,通过盆栽试验,设置接种AMF、接种MHB、双接种AMF和MHB处理,并以不接种处理为对照,研究不同接种方式对番茄生长及营养吸收的影响,明确AMF和MHB互作对番茄生长的影响,以期为菌根化技术及番茄的可持续发展提供参考依据。结果表明:与对照相比,单一接种AMF(Fm)处理、单一接种MHB(Ba)处理以及同时接种AMF和MHB(FB)处理的番茄幼苗植株地上部、地下部及全株鲜干质量均得到提高。与对照相比,接种AMF、MHB以及混合接种AMF和MHB,均提高了植株氮、磷、钾浓度和营养含量以及土壤速效钾、有效磷、硝态氨、铵态氮含量。其中,同时接种AMF和MHB(FB)处理,对番茄生长、植株养分及土壤状况等指标的促进作用最大,单一接种AMF(Fm)处理的促进效用次之,单一接种MHB(Ba)处理的促进作用相对较小。综上,接种AMF和MHB均在促进番茄生长方面发挥重要作用,双接种AMF与MHB对番茄生长的促进作用最大。 Taking tomato(Solanum lycopersicum L.)as the test material,a pot experiment was performed,AMF inoculation,MHB inoculation,double inoculation AMF and MHB was set up,and no inoculation treatment as the control.The effects of different inoculation methods on the growth and nutrient uptake of tomato were studied,the influence of AMF and MHB interaction on tomato growth were clarified,in order to provide reference for mycorrhizal technology and sustainable development of tomato.The results showed that compared with the control,the aboveground,underground and whole fresh dry weight of tomato seedlings with single AMF(Fm),single injection MHB(Ba)treatment and simultaneous injection of AMF and MHB(FB)treatment were increased.Compared with the control,inoculation with AMF,MHB separately and mixed inoculation with AMF and MHB increased the nitrogen,phosphorus and potassium concentrations and nutrient contents of plants,as well as soil available potassium,available phosphorus,nitrate ammonia and ammonium nitrogen.Among them,simultaneous inoculation with AMF and MHB(FB)treatment had the greatest promotion effect on tomato growth,plant nutrients and soil conditions,while single inoculation with AMF(Fm)treatment had the second most promotional effect,and single inoculation with MHB(Ba)treatment had relatively small promoting effect.In summary,both AMF and MHB inoculation played an important role in promoting tomato growth,and double inoculation of AMF and MHB had the greatest effect on tomato growth.
